Essential Functions
  • Teaches and facilitates student learning in the clinical setting; teaching activities may occur online or face-to‑face in a classroom, clinical, lab, or fieldwork setting.
  • Builds degree programs that embody coherent courses of study and allow students to progressively build upon and integrate their knowledge and skills.
  • Develops knowledge of pedagogy, academic discipline, and as appropriate, clinical profession including scholarship activities.
  • Contributes to the improvement of the College community through service to the College and broader community.
Physical Requirements
  • Normal or corrected auditory and visual acuity.
  • Able to use standard office equipment, including computers.
  • Environment is climate controlled with occasional exposure to inclement weather when travelling between buildings.
  • Occasional travel to other locations.
Education, Experience and Certifications
  • Demonstrates high level of competence in teaching and related activities. Minimum of a Master's degree in Nursing required.
  • Current or eligible applicable state RN license required.
  • Minimum of 2 years clinical experience as RN required.
  • Experience teaching in a pre‑licensure nursing program preferred.
Training Requirements
  • Completion of 45 contact hours of continuing education courses.
  • Completion of a certificate program in nursing education.
  • 9 semester hours of education coursework;
    National certification in nursing education.

Facilitates educational experiences to enhance student learning; teaches, advises students; curriculum development; student retention; active committee involvement; professional development; participates in budget and institutional effectiveness processes; services to the greater community in the clinical environment.
